Hi, In the last few weeks we have seen several reports about remote worker issues due to SIP aware devices between remote worker and sipXecs or due to service providers blocking SIP traffic on standard SIP ports. In my sipXecs setup I have experienced cases with remote workers connecting from various parts of the world either - have a local SIP-aware layer 3 device or - service provider either deploying a SIP-aware device or blocking SIP traffic in their network
In the above cases the SIP-aware devices are doing damage, while in the later case the service provider is effectively shutting down remote worker setup. I am looking at two options for solving this problem: 1. Allow admin to change the SIP proxy port from standard 5060 to non-standard port. This works around SIP-aware devices and non-network neutral service providers. Combined with the ability to configure the phone to use non-standard SIP port, we can isolate ourselves from and issues introduced by the network. In this first case, I would like to have a way to change the standard listening SIP ports (both UDP and TCP) via admin UI. At the moment there is no way to do that without manually modifying configuration files, which then get overwritten by configuration changes. 2. At least in one case of an unsophisticated ISP I was able to work around the blocking UDP port 5060 issue by having the phone to switch to TCP. I have experimented with Polycom and Counterpath SMC clients, configured to use TCP as a transport, trying to force them to only use TCP transport communicating with sipXecs. However, I was not able to achieve this in all cases. Apart from documented case, where Polycom switches to UDP during MWI subscription refresh (http://track.sipfoundry.org/browse/XTRN-609) I have the most basic call scenario of Polycom or SMC calling VM. 200OK from the VM has: Contact with transport=tcp, but record-route with no transport parameter. Both Polycom and SMC send ACK via UDP. I realize sipXecs is not obligated to set transport in RR, but at least in the case of remote worker, who registered via TCP, in may be the logical thing to do. We already send out-of-dialog requests toward the remote worker using the transport protocol taken from registration record. Why not modify the RR based on the registration. Even though one can argue that the phone configured to use TCP protocol should stick to TCP even when facing the freedom on using either UDP or TCP, there is no harm in forcing the transport to TCP in the case of a remote worker registered via TCP. I would like to propose to track both options via JIRA tracker. Each option has its value independently of the other.
